Description:
The firm wants to make risk management intelligent and proactive, and bring roof maintenance into the 4.0 era. Through discussions with customers and partners working in the roofing field, many have expressed interest in a solution that would enable autonomous monitoring and automatic detection of hot spots on the roof following the installation of a roofing membrane involving the use of a flashlight. The project involves further research and development to validate the technical feasibility of the project, and to consolidate what has been learned by creating a prototype version that meets the functional requirements.
